dc.description.abstract Difficult-to-machine materials are still challenging the production industry. Examples are highly complex components of aircraft engines. Alongside innovative processes, also improved machine tool components are helping to comply with the demands of this task. This paper presents a swivel rotary table with an active magnetic bearing (AMB). Opportunities in machining through employing a workpiece-sided AMB are presented. The inherent capabilities to work as a sensor and actor as well as its stiffness and damping depend on the precise knowledge of the magnets characteristics. Therefore, a methodology to automatically identify the characteristic curve is presented. eng
